A leap year (also known as an intercalary year or bissextile year) is a calendar year that contains an additional day (or, in the case of a lunisolar calendar, a month) compared to a common year. The 366th day (or 13th month) is added to keep the calendar year synchronised with the astronomical year or seasonal year . [ 1 ]

The denomination 1 BC for this year has been used since the early medieval period when the Anno Domini calendar era became the prevalent method in Europe for naming years. The following year is AD 1 in the widely used Julian calendar and the proleptic Gregorian calendar, which both do not have a "year zero".
